Abstract

There are many studies on magnetic levitation, some of which were already realized in railways. The authors in our laboratory now try to apply the magnetic levitation techniques to the steel processing industry. Therefore, we aim at the construction of magnetic levitation system for very thin steel plates. However, it is extremely difficult to levitate them perfectly, because of its vibratory properties and awkward electromagnetic properties. We have already studied the elasticity of the thin steel plate mechanically and shown its control methodology. In this research, we carry out many measurements about “the magnetic saturation and the magnetic leakage” and formulate its influence. Last, with a controller designed by considering the influence, we accomplish a stable levitation for a very thin steel plate.
